Title
A Study on Characteristics of Rapid Biofilter Clarifier for a Pretreatment of Municipal Wastewater
강용태 Kang Yong Tae , 장성부 Jang Seong Bu
Abstract
It is not easy to find reasonable area for construction of wastewater treatment facility, and biological treatment such as a conventional activated sludge process can`t remove non-point source pollutant in initial rainfall, sufficiently. So if we use bio-physical treatment as pre-treatment and disinfection process, combined sewer overflows don`t cause significant pollution. First of all, we thought the site can be reduced by the reduction of HRT(hydraulic retention time). In this study, to reduce HRT of wastewater treatment facility, the rapid biofilter clarifier was cofigurated and its characteristics were analyzed according to the velocity of filtration and cycles of backwash. Specific characteristics of the rapid biofilter clarifier with 50 ㎥/d of volume were represented that Turbidity and SS removal rate was 30.2%, 30.9% respectively, and that of BOD and COD was 22.0%, 21.0% without regard to change of quality of raw water. By comparing the rapid biofilter clarifier and sedimentation of conventional activated sludge process with haveing 50㎥/㎡· of surface-loading rate and 2.0m of depth, we could know the rapid biofilter clarifier could reduce area of clarifier 11 times as much than that of conventional activated sludge process. Cycle of backwash was represented as 24, 18 and 24 hours when velocity of filtration was 222㎥/㎡·d, 333㎥/㎡·d and 555㎥/㎡·d, and BOD, SS biologically removed in the rapid biofilter clarifier was 342.80, 346.82 g/d, 258.08, 222.72 g/d, and 142.36, 136.52g/d respectively.
